Simplifying x + -5y = 43 Solving x + -5y = 43 Solving for variable 'x'.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'5y' to each side of the equation. x + -5y + 5y = 43 + 5y Combine like terms: -5y + 5y = 0 x + 0 = 43 + 5y x = 43 + 5y Simplifying x = 43 + 5y
